The Foundation: Duke University Salary and Base Earnings
For the majority of his career, Coach K’s financial standing was anchored by his role as the head men’s basketball coach at Duke University. His compensation package with Duke was substantial, reflecting his status as a premier architect of college basketball. While specific annual figures fluctuated over his 40-plus years with the Blue Devils, his base salary, combined with performance bonuses and incentives, consistently placed him among the highest-paid coaches in the nation. This steady stream of income provided the primary foundation for his overall Coach K net worth long before he transitioned to his current role as a special advisor.
Endorsements and Corporate Partnerships
Unlike many college coaches, Coach K successfully leveraged his clean-cut image and winning legacy into a robust portfolio of external endorsements. He became a familiar and trusted face in major national campaigns, most notably for corporations like Nike, which maintained a strong partnership with Duke basketball. These deals, often spanning years, added significant figures to his annual earnings. His ability to maintain a positive public persona and reputation for integrity made him a valuable asset for brands seeking credibility and mainstream appeal, directly contributing to his wealth accumulation.
